Babylonian Talmud, Baba Kama 60:1
תאני רב יוסף מאי דכתיב (שמות יב) ואתם לא תצאו איש מפתח ביתו עד בקר כיון שניתן רשות למשחית אינו מבחין בין צדיקים לרשעים
Rav Yosef taught: "What is the meaning of the verse: 'None of you shall go outside the door of your house until morning' [Exodus 12:22]? Once permission has been given to the Destroyer, it does not differentiate between righteous and wicked. [Soncino translation]
